Dr. Christian Ray to receive 2019 Karen Wold Level the Learning Field Award

Date
04/15/19

The Karen Wold Level the Learning Field Award is given by the Division of Disability Resources and Educational Services (DRES) in memory of Karen Wold who was an access specialist at DRES. Karen spent her career engaging with her students and faculty to find solutions to academic challenges. She wanted to make the learning field more level and accessible to all. 


The purpose of the award is to identify exemplary members of the Illinois faculty and staff to advocate and/or implement educational strategies, technologies and accommodations related to disabilities that provide equal access to academic resources and curricula for students with disabilities. Dr. Christian Ray was nominated for this award because he has been pro-active with his students with disabilities who have taken his chemistry classes. To quote the nomination: "Dr. Ray is one of the most caring and compassionate professors I have worked with. He is welcoming and inviting to all students. He has continuously reached out asking for educational materials on how to best interact with a student who may have a disability and recommends to the student that they use DRES as a resource." Ray will be presented the award during the DRES Awards Program on April 25.
